Working parents now gain relief from both income tax and National Insurance Contributions on the first £243 per month (£55 per week) paid to a Registered or Approved Carer under a ‘salary sacrifice’ arrangement. This can yield annual net savings of up to £1,195.

care-4 is the UK’s premier childcare payment system, an ‘electronic voucher’ for working parents to pay approved carers efficiently and cost-effectively. To benefit from the scheme, employees commit to regular childcare payment by means of a ‘salary sacrifice’ implemented via their employer’s payroll. The employer’s NI contribution on this amount is refunded.

A sum equivalent to the ‘salary sacrifice’ is placed in a secure care-4 account and made available for childcare payments to designated, eligible carers by simple telephoned instructions without the administration and hassle of paper vouchers.
